Donna King has a special goal--to send a blanket to every name with an email address on the Project Linus Chapter Listings web page. If you've peeked at this page, you know that's quite a task! Donna writes: I really wanted to do this quietly on my own and at my own pace. Lord willing in my lifetime my ultimate plan is to send blankets to not only our wonderful country but to Canada and England also... When I started this goal over a year ago I wanted to do something that would dry someone’s tears and maybe even make them smile along the way. I can’t recall how I heard about Project Linus but the person talking about it said, “It’s like wrapping a child in a hug.” Well, I’m a hugger and I knew that was exactly what I wanted to do. My first blanket went out on March 7th 2001 to Marilyn Marks. She was wonderful and very encouraging. I have met some WONDERFUL people whose hearts are just busting out with love for these kids! Project Linus applauds Donna’s efforts, and is proud to report that she’s well on her way to achieving her goal. Keep those blankets and hugs coming!
